29 #include <sys/types.h>
30 
31 __RCSID("$NetBSD: sigstackalign.c,v 1.3 2008/04/28 20:23:05 martin Exp $");
32 
33 #include <signal.h>
34 #include <stdio.h>
35 #include <stdlib.h>
36 
37 #define RANGE 16
38 #define STACKALIGN 8
39 #define BLOCKSIZE (MINSIGSTKSZ + RANGE)
40 
41 extern void getstackptr(int);
42 
43 void *stackptr;
44 
45 int
46 main(int argc, char **argv)
47 {
48 	char *stackblock;
49 	int i, ret;
50 	struct sigaction sa;
51 	stack_t ss;
52 
53 	ret = 0;
54 
55 	sa.sa_handler = getstackptr;
56 	sigemptyset(&sa.sa_mask);
57 	sa.sa_flags = SA_ONSTACK;
58 	if (sigaction(SIGUSR1, &sa, NULL) != 0)
59 		err(1, "sigaction");
60 
61 	stackblock = malloc(BLOCKSIZE);
62 	for (i = 0; i < RANGE; i++) {
63 		ss.ss_sp = stackblock;
64 		ss.ss_size = MINSIGSTKSZ + i;
65 		ss.ss_flags = 0;
66 		if (sigaltstack(&ss, NULL) != 0)
67 			err(1, "sigaltstack");
68 		kill(getpid(), SIGUSR1);
69 		if ((u_int)stackptr % STACKALIGN != 0) {
70 			fprintf(stderr, "Bad stack pointer %p\n", stackptr);
71 			ret = 1;
72 		}
73 #if 0
74 		printf("i = %d, stackptr = %p\n", i, stackptr);
75 #endif
76 	}
77 
78 	return ret;
79 }
